Tuberculose em município de porte médio do Sudeste do Brasil: indicadores de morbidade e mortalidade, de 1985 a 2003

Abstract: INTRODUÇÃO: A tuberculose é uma doença ligada à pobreza, má distribuição de renda, urbanização, epidemia da síndrome da imunodeficiência adquirida, e multirresistência. OBJETIVO: Analisar indicadores de morbidade e mortalidade por tuberculose de São José do Rio Preto, entre 1985 e 2003, comparados com os do Estado de São Paulo e Brasil. Verificar a relação entre risco de ocorrência da doença e níveis socioeconômicos. MÉTODO: Sistemas de informações utilizados: Mortalidade (SIM), Notificação de Tuberculose (Epi… Show more
